The M-Tac CCW Sling Bag is a compact, water-resistant tactical shoulder bag designed for concealed carry enthusiasts. Made from durable 600D polyester with PVC coating, it features a universal holster insert for quick weapon access, multiple compartments for organized EDC gear, and an ergonomic crossbody design suitable for men and women. Perfect for daily use, travel, or outdoor activities, this bag combines security, comfort, and style in one elite package.

Excellent Bag For Women, Contents Easily Accessible
Great bag, good quality. I'm a female, 5'5", 135 lbs and the bag stays in place when I wear it around the front or back. It's easy to quickly swing around to the front if you have the bag portion settled on your back. It's almost as if it's not there when I'm wearing it, even when it's packed. For me, it is much more comfortable than your typical crossbody concealed carry purse and the contents are much easier to access. I added a metal clip to the pull tab, which makes it much easier for me to quickly pull open the zippered portion and access what's inside if needed. It may not be necessary for others, but practice with the pull tab and see how it works for you. To give you an idea of interior size, this easily holds a Byrna SD, extra magazines and extra ammo, as well as other self-defense items. The strap portion closest to the bag is also sturdy enough that I can clip a heavy Motorola radio to it, keeping it close and always at hand. This is a really great item for women who want to carry self-defense items, but who typically wouldn't wear a tactical or range belt. Aside from using it as a concealed carry bag, this would also make a great bag to use when you go shopping, hiking, or are doing anything where you need both of your hands. I couldn't be happier with this item. Great value, too.

Excellent CCW bag for EDC
First, I really do love this bag. I’ve gotten out of the habit of carrying on a daily basis because it’s just too inconvenient. This bag has changed that. I don’t keep anything in my pockets anymore. I just grab this bag and go. It’s the perfect size, just big enough to fit a reasonable size CCW but doesn’t look like I’m carrying around a full size backpack on my chest. My P365 fits perfectly, but I think I could probably fit my P320 if I wanted to. I’ve opted for the lighter P365 for EDC, even in the bag. I have 2 complaints/opportunities for improvement. First, and simplest to fix, is the zipper pulls. The paracord is kind of ridiculous, big and bulky. This is easily fixed by some low profile zipper pulls for $4 here on Amazon: https://a.co/d/0a3BVeeT Second, and harder to fix is the shoulder strap. It’s too wide. I get that it’s more sturdy and rugged, but it sits on my shoulder weird and tries to cut into my neck. This might be less of a problem if it weren’t for the real issue, the 45 degree angle of the bottom strap attachment is all wrong. Maybe it’s because I have a thicker chest, I don’t know, but I sincerely wish this either came out of the bag at a 90 degree angle or, even better, attached on some sort of swivel, like a ring with a quick release clip. Bottom line, replace the zipper pulls and figure out how to change the angle of the bottom strap attachment, and this would be the absolute perfect EDC CCW chest/cross body bag. One last tip, I bought a strong flush mount MagSafe wall mount and put it in the front pocket. It’s a perfect mount for easy access to my phone.

Great bag for easy grab and go
I usually wear my carry weapon on my waist via a belly band or holster on my belt. However, there are times when I'm just making a quick run and don't want to "get dressed". In those cases, it is very quick and easy to throw a piece in this bag, with a couple extra mags and head out. It will hold one handgun easily with a place for 2 extra mags. There are plenty of pockets for almost any other accessory you would want to carry (flashlight, knife, defense spray, wallet, keys, medicine, sunglasses, reading glasses, etc.). I don't see many guys carrying shoulder bags but I don't understand why. This is a very easy and comfortable way to conceal and carry a handgun. You can carry extra mags easily and the accessibility is pretty quick (but you have to practice). Maybe it will become more mainstream for guys to carry. I really don't care what anyone else thinks as long as I feel safe. This gives me a sense of security at times that I might, otherwise, not carry at all. You can judge me all you want for my "man purse" or "murse" but I'll be ready if/when the time comes that I need to defend myself with lethal force. This is a good quality bag with a lot of room for extras.
